im类产品如何实现智能语音搜索功能?

随着科技的不断发展,智能语音搜索功能已经成为了许多产品的标配。IM类产品作为即时通讯工具,其智能语音搜索功能更是能够提升用户体验,增强产品的竞争力。那么,IM类产品如何实现智能语音搜索功能呢?本文将从以下几个方面进行探讨。

一、语音识别技术

  1. 确保语音识别的准确性

语音识别是智能语音搜索功能的基础,其准确性直接影响到用户体验。为了提高语音识别的准确性,IM类产品可以采取以下措施:

(1)采用先进的语音识别算法,如深度学习、神经网络等,以提高识别精度。

(2)优化语音信号处理技术,如噪声抑制、回声消除等,降低环境噪声对识别结果的影响。

(3)结合语音上下文信息,实现多轮对话识别,提高识别准确率。


  1. 支持多种语音输入方式

为了满足不同用户的需求,IM类产品应支持多种语音输入方式,如普通话、方言、外语等。同时,针对不同场景,如车载、智能家居等,提供相应的语音输入优化方案。

二、自然语言处理技术

  1. 语义理解

自然语言处理技术是实现智能语音搜索功能的关键。通过语义理解,IM类产品可以更好地理解用户的意图,从而提供更精准的搜索结果。以下是一些提高语义理解能力的措施:

(1)采用先进的自然语言处理算法,如词向量、依存句法分析等,深入挖掘语义信息。

(2)结合用户画像,根据用户的兴趣、习惯等个性化信息,提高语义理解准确性。

(3)不断优化算法,使系统具备更强的泛化能力,适应更多场景。


  1. 语音合成

在智能语音搜索功能中,语音合成技术将搜索结果转化为语音输出。以下是一些提高语音合成质量的措施:

(1)采用高质量的语音合成引擎,如百度语音合成、科大讯飞语音合成等。

(2)优化语音合成算法,使语音流畅自然,符合用户听力习惯。

(3)根据用户性别、年龄等个性化信息,调整语音合成风格。

三、搜索算法优化

  1. 搜索引擎优化

为了提高搜索结果的准确性,IM类产品需要优化搜索引擎算法。以下是一些优化措施:

(1)采用先进的搜索引擎算法,如深度学习、图神经网络等,提高搜索结果的准确性。

(2)结合用户画像,根据用户的兴趣、习惯等个性化信息,优化搜索结果排序。

(3)实时更新搜索引擎索引,确保搜索结果的时效性。


  1. 搜索结果展示优化

为了提高用户体验,IM类产品需要对搜索结果进行优化展示。以下是一些优化措施:

(1)采用可视化展示方式,如列表、卡片等,提高搜索结果的易读性。

(2)针对不同场景,如聊天、购物等,提供个性化的搜索结果展示。

(3)优化搜索结果排序,确保搜索结果的相关性。

四、用户反馈与优化

  1. 用户反馈机制

为了不断优化智能语音搜索功能,IM类产品应建立完善的用户反馈机制。以下是一些反馈机制:

(1)提供便捷的反馈渠道,如在线客服、社区论坛等。

(2)对用户反馈进行分类、整理,分析用户需求。

(3)根据用户反馈,持续优化产品功能。


  1. 持续优化

智能语音搜索功能需要不断优化,以下是一些优化方向:

(1)提高语音识别、自然语言处理等技术水平。

(2)优化搜索算法,提高搜索结果的准确性。

(3)丰富搜索结果展示形式,提升用户体验。

总之,IM类产品实现智能语音搜索功能需要从多个方面进行优化。通过不断探索和创新,为用户提供更加便捷、高效的语音搜索体验。

猜你喜欢:直播聊天室